掌握虛擬現(xiàn)實開發(fā)基礎知識的關鍵要點
虛擬現(xiàn)實(Virtual Reality,VR)技術正在迅速改變我們的生活方式,無論是在娛樂、教育還是企業(yè)領域,都得到了廣泛的應用。如果您對虛擬現(xiàn)實開發(fā)感興趣,掌握基礎知識是至關重要的。在本文中,我們將介紹幾個關鍵要點,幫助您快速學習虛擬現(xiàn)實開發(fā)。
了解虛擬現(xiàn)實的基本原理
了解虛擬現(xiàn)實的基本原理是學習開發(fā)的第一步。虛擬現(xiàn)實是通過計算機生成的模擬環(huán)境,讓用戶感覺仿佛置身于其中。主要包括三個關鍵要素:頭戴式顯示器、追蹤設備和用戶接口。頭戴式顯示器可以讓用戶看到虛擬環(huán)境,追蹤設備可以跟蹤用戶的位置和動作,用戶接口則提供與虛擬環(huán)境交互的手段。
選擇合適的開發(fā)平臺
選擇合適的開發(fā)平臺是學習虛擬現(xiàn)實開發(fā)的重要決策。目前市面上有許多虛擬現(xiàn)實開發(fā)平臺可供選擇,如Unity、Unreal Engine等。這些平臺提供了豐富的開發(fā)工具和資源,能夠幫助開發(fā)者快速構建虛擬現(xiàn)實應用。
掌握基本的編程語言
掌握基本的編程語言是進行虛擬現(xiàn)實開發(fā)的必備技能。虛擬現(xiàn)實開發(fā)涉及到多個方面的編程技術,包括圖形渲染、物理模擬、用戶交互等。常用的編程語言有C++、C#、Python等,選擇一門適合自己的語言并深入學習,能夠幫助您更好地理解和實現(xiàn)虛擬現(xiàn)實應用。
學習虛擬現(xiàn)實開發(fā)的相關理論
學習虛擬現(xiàn)實開發(fā)的相關理論是提升開發(fā)能力的重要途徑。深入了解虛擬現(xiàn)實的核心概念、算法和技術,能夠幫助您更好地理解虛擬現(xiàn)實的本質,并在實際開發(fā)中做出準確的決策。了解光線追蹤、立體視覺、空間定位等相關理論,能夠幫助您更好地解決開發(fā)過程中遇到的問題。
做好用戶體驗設計和優(yōu)化
用戶體驗在虛擬現(xiàn)實開發(fā)中至關重要。虛擬現(xiàn)實應用意味著用戶身臨其境的體驗,因此,設計一個流暢、舒適、易用的用戶界面是至關重要的。同時,還需要關注應用的性能優(yōu)化,確保應用在各種硬件平臺上都能夠流暢運行。
總結
通過掌握虛擬現(xiàn)實的基本原理、選擇適合的開發(fā)平臺、掌握基本的編程語言、學習虛擬現(xiàn)實開發(fā)的相關理論,并注重用戶體驗設計和優(yōu)化,您將能夠快速掌握虛擬現(xiàn)實開發(fā)的基礎知識,并將其應用于實際項目中。四度科技致力于為開發(fā)者提供先進的虛擬現(xiàn)實開發(fā)平臺和優(yōu)質的技術支持,幫助您在虛擬現(xiàn)實領域取得成功。